A Bedtime Snack Alternative That Helps You Wind Down

You’ll be amazed how a simple snack can tame a restless mind and signal your body to unwind. If you choose a small, balanced option—about 100–200 calories, 30–60 minutes before bed—you create a smooth crossover from wakefulness to sleep. Think yogurt with berries or nut butter with whole-grain crackers. This approach aims for lighter fats, steady protein or complex carbs, and fewer awakenings, but you’ll want to tailor portions based on mood and alertness to see what truly helps you drift off.

Consider a simple, evidence-aligned choice: a 150-calorie combination of a rapid digestion cue and a slow-release anchor. A practical formulation includes a modest portion of yogurt or kefir paired with a handful of berries, or a small spoon of nut butter with whole-grain crackers. The protein supports satiety through sleep, while fiber from fruit or fiber-rich crackers moderates digestion. The fat in nut butter slows absorption, helping to maintain steady internal conditions through the night. You’ll document how quickly you feel satisfied and whether you fall asleep within a target window, typically 10 to 20 minutes after lights out, without mid-sleep awakenings.

To implement, you’ll schedule a fixed window 30 to 60 minutes before your usual lights-out time. You’ll consume mindfully, avoiding liquid-heavy intake that could prompt nocturnal trips to the bathroom. You’ll monitor subjective clarity on waking, mood, and perceived restfulness, and note any deviations across nights. If you notice persistent grogginess, you’ll reassess portions, timing, or composition to preserve a stable bedtime routine. Are There Risks With Late-Night Caffeine or Chocolate?

Yes, there are risks with late-night caffeine or chocolate. You should consider caffeine timing to minimize sleep disruption, as even small amounts close to bedtime can delay sleep onset. The chocolate impact depends on cocoa and sugar content; dark chocolate has more caffeine than milk and can still disturb sleep if eaten late. Track how late you consume these items, and adjust timing or choose non-caffeinated alternatives to protect sleep quality.
